    A live, semi-improvised synthesizer jam performed entirely on hardware.
    In my previous video, I tried the Walrus Slöer reverb pedal with a few fun synths. During that session, I stumbled into a chord progression on the Nymphes that sounded really lovely with the Slöer, and this track was born from it.
    I knew it needed some accompaniment that matched the feeling, so I brought out the GR-1, my favourite granular hardware. With its four-layer timbrality, I could both create textures, and also use a timbre to double the Nymphes for some building/progression. I'm really happy with how hardware explorations can quickly lead to finished songs, and this is no exception.
    Dreadbox Nymphes into Walrus Slöer - Pad
    Tasty Chips GR-1 into Meris LVX - Four granular synth sounds
    Arturia Keystep 37 - MIDI controller
    Kenton MIDI Thru (not seen) - MIDI Thru
    Performed and recorded live, with EQ, compression, and limiting on the master.

    Was that just one voice being used on the granular and you are boosting the decay? I've got one but struggle to integrate it into my workflow. Excellent sounds!

    • @JayHosking
      @JayHosking  Рік тому +2

      No, it's four different timbres on the GR-1. Three are playing (with the play button), and one is receiving the same MIDI data as the Nymphes (shows up partway through the song). And thanks!
